UBA Partners Aura By Transcorp, Rolls Out Summer Deals For Customers

United Bank for Africa (UBA) Plc, has said it is partnering with Aura by Tanscorp, to roll out its summer campaign that will see its customers enjoy exclusive benefits and discounts for customers with UBA debit and prepaid cards.

The summer campaign, with the theme “#UBA Summer Memories,” is to run from August 17 to September 7, 2024, and holds and would have customers enjoy benefits including a 10 per cent discount on all bookings.

Asides this, one customer will get a free night stay worth N150,000; five customers will win N20,000 discounts on their spa vouchers, 10 customers will also get N15,000 discounts on apartment bookings, while another 10 UBA customers will get N10,000 discount on hotel bookings.

Commenting on the campaign, UBA’s Group Head, Retail and Digital Banking, Shamsideen Fashola, emphasised the bank’s commitment towards encouraging savings culture, recreation, lifestyle, and rewarding loyalty among its customers.

“That is why we would be offering our loyal customers travelling abroad for vacation up to 35% discount off their flights tickets, hotel bookings, shopping, and car rentals, as well as the chance to win other amazing prizes, when they make use of their UBA VISA or Mastercard Dollar Cards for transactions”, Fashola said.

He added, “This promotion underscores our commitment to enhancing the lifestyle of our customers. We recognize the importance of work and rest and as a bank that puts customers first in all we do, we are keen to make our customers enjoy both seasons with ease. By using the UBA Dollar cards to make payments this season, our customers will gain a lot of great benefits”.

Also speaking on the summer campaign, UBA’s Group Head, Marketing & Corporate Communications, Alero Ladipo, encouraged customers to share their beautiful summer memories on social media with the hashtag #UBASummerMemories for a chance to win a weekend staycation at a luxury resort.

She said, “We’re inviting our customers to share their summer experiences using the hashtag #UBASummerMemories across all social media platforms. This initiative aims to create a sense of community among our users and also offers them the chance to win more amazing prizes.
